Output 78146258987e8e83b2f7f4bd44b28dac851a742044f32fc75a9f065a81c9a89a:1

value
274880246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18bc4f8d6f0ef4a6c2d84cf14131db03aa66a2c2 OP_EQUAL
address
33wojD2JrnXnhWyqXBifkNuE2YguUmNWSh
transaction
78146258987e8e83b2f7f4bd44b28dac851a742044f32fc75a9f065a81c9a89a
spent
true